## Signing VRAM-Scope artifacts

Hey newcomers — VRAM-Scope is our GPU memory profiling toolkit, and every binary we ship gets signed before it lands in the Corbel registry. The build bot signs automatically on tagged commits, but if you cut a hotfix by hand you must sign it yourself or the agents will refuse to load the profiler. Verify your local build against the team key below.

release key, hadug-kawef: bky13_mPGeFZeR1GZ1G

# FANOUT_QUEUE_HIGH_WATERMARK sets the per-shard pending-notification
# limit before the Pigeonpost fan-out workers start shedding low-priority
# sends. Below this value we deliver everything in order; above it,
# digest-class notifications are deferred to the retry lane so that
# transactional pushes stay within SLO. The value was tuned against the
# Novarra load rig at 3x peak traffic. Benchmarks supporting this number
# were captured on the build noted below.

pipeline stamp: htk21_104c5ba7d0df6b2897cd5

**Action item (Grainfall incident 2024-11):** Report exports rendered timestamps in the server's local zone instead of the tenant's configured zone, so overnight batches showed the wrong business day. Fix: all export workers must resolve the tenant zone at job start and pass it explicitly; never rely on process defaults. Add a regression test covering DST transitions in both directions. If you touch export code, read this first — it is the most common new-hire mistake. The retry and cutoff constants are below.

limits module of tawep-hawif:
WEIGHTS = {
    "sordor": 228,
    "kasax": 458,
    "ulaox": 8,
    "casix": 495,
    "briix": 335,
}

## Configuration — SnackRoute Planner

The restock planner reads its settings from a single `.env` file at the repo root. Set `SNACKROUTE_REGION` to your depot code and `PLAN_HORIZON_DAYS` to the forecast window (default 7). Machine telemetry comes from the Vendelka feed, polled every ten minutes. New team members should request depot access before first run. The telemetry feed's access credential is set on the line below.

sealed setting: VAULT_KEY5=54f99